caveolin1缺失对局灶性脑缺血小鼠神经功能及脑梗死面积的影响

Effect of caveolin1 on nerve function and infarct volume in mice after focal cerebral ischemia

中文摘要英文摘要

目的:评价caveolin1对局灶性脑缺血损伤中的作用。方法:分别对 caveolin1基因敲除小鼠和同源野生C57小鼠行MCAO术造成脑缺血损伤模型。于术后1d、7d进行TTC染色、大脑干湿质量比,评价梗死体积比脑水肿程度,并进行神经功能评分。结果:与野生型小鼠比较,caveolin1基因缺失加重MCAO脑损伤,减缓其神经功能恢复,加重脑水肿。结论:caveolin-1在MCAO早期可能具有抗脑损伤和脑保护作用。

Objective:To evaluate the role of caveolin1 in mice after focal cerebral schemia.Methods:Mice(CAV1+/+ AND CAV1-/-) were reproduced by middle cerebral artery occlusion, Neurological functional score were evaluated after surgery before the execution, 5 rats were randomly taken from each group and calculated infarct size ratio by TTC, others were calculat the ratio of wet and dry brain. Results:Compared with wild-type mice,CAV1 deletion can significant delays restoration of neurological deficits and infarct size and abate the brain edema in mice.Conclusion:Caveolin1 may play a protective role in mice after focal cerebral ischemia.
